Commit Graph

379 Commits

Author SHA1 Message Date
Nicolas Lœuillet
ce782c84b8 fix bug on detect active theme 2015-10-06 20:51:40 +02:00
Nicolas Lœuillet
1ce8f30342 fix type hint for User 2015-10-06 12:16:08 +02:00
Jeremy Benoist
16dabc3263 Merge pull request #1436 from wallabag/v2-register
Public registration & oAuth2 \o/
2015-10-06 09:19:06 +02:00
Jeremy Benoist
fdef5f4605 Merge pull request #1461 from wallabag/v2-test-for-www
fix #1433: add test for removeWww Twig Extension
2015-10-06 09:16:52 +02:00
Nicolas Lœuillet
784bb4c38d add test for removeWww Twig Extension 2015-10-06 09:09:26 +02:00
Nicolas Lœuillet
8263e71192 use form widget for registration 2015-10-06 07:44:10 +02:00
Nicolas Lœuillet
68e9dcf615 restore blue color 2015-10-06 06:16:17 +02:00
Nicolas Lœuillet
e0d188809c move css 2015-10-05 22:49:46 +02:00
Nicolas Lœuillet
d30262154a last changes for baggy theme 2015-10-05 22:45:44 +02:00
Nicolas Lœuillet
ec3ce598f6 material design for register/login/recover pages 2015-10-05 22:16:18 +02:00
Thomas Citharel
9c8f7af196 fix #1457 2015-10-05 21:37:17 +02:00
Jeremy Benoist
4c5e544183 Cleanup
- remove unecessary routing for UserBundle
- remove unused form type
2015-10-03 13:37:21 +02:00
Nicolas Lœuillet
0a878469d4 move some files to UserBundle 2015-10-03 13:31:48 +02:00
Nicolas Lœuillet
1210dae105 remove old implementation for login/register/recover 2015-10-03 13:31:48 +02:00
Jeremy Benoist
772d8c4b93 Add test on RegistrationConfirmedListener
And PLEASE @nicosomb, NEVER EVER inject the whole container inside a service.
2015-10-03 13:30:43 +02:00
Nicolas Lœuillet
2c13918acc add test for confirmed registration 2015-10-03 13:30:43 +02:00
Nicolas Lœuillet
359b3f43cc * rename AuthenticationListener
* add tests
2015-10-03 13:30:43 +02:00
Nicolas Lœuillet
772732531e check authentication on each API route 2015-10-03 13:30:43 +02:00
Nicolas Lœuillet
fcb1fba5c2 * public registration
* remove WSSE implementation
* add oAuth2 implementation
2015-10-03 13:30:43 +02:00
Thomas Citharel
4b55e704ab typo 2015-10-01 18:48:38 +02:00
Nicolas Lœuillet
4e9f656ecb restore footer 2015-10-01 11:38:59 +02:00
Nicolas Lœuillet
cfb28c9da0 french translation 2015-10-01 09:26:52 +02:00
Nicolas Lœuillet
8e417206d5 flash messages translation 2015-09-30 18:17:40 +02:00
Nicolas Lœuillet
4aafa7f0df french translation 2015-09-30 18:09:18 +02:00
Nicolas Lœuillet
4f0dfac6a6 add french translation 2015-09-30 17:06:41 +02:00
Jeremy Benoist
7c99da0c95 Merge pull request #1437 from wallabag/v2-clean-material
some cleanup on material theme
2015-09-30 09:05:03 +02:00
Nicolas Lœuillet
72fcaf8a6c remove www. on entries view 2015-09-29 22:59:44 +02:00
Nicolas Lœuillet
b0b352fc8e some cleanup on material theme 2015-09-29 20:26:32 +02:00
Nicolas Lœuillet
917040d4a0 Merge pull request #1434 from wallabag/travis-db
Add multiple database tests on Travis
2015-09-28 22:57:11 +02:00
Jeremy Benoist
02d17813a1 Fix tests for all 2015-09-28 20:26:37 +02:00
Jeremy Benoist
159986c4fb Fix Postgres tests 2015-09-28 19:35:55 +02:00
Jeremy Benoist
da3d4998c0 Move readingTime & domainName in ContentProxy
So, everything is centralized in one place when we save a new entry.
2015-09-28 19:35:33 +02:00
Jeremy Benoist
0f30f48b93 Enabled created user from Config
By default, creating user with FOSUser are disabled by default.

Fix #1423
2015-09-26 19:45:14 +02:00
Jeremy Benoist
d4ebe5c5dc Entries filter on language
+ updated deps
2015-09-23 07:55:55 +02:00
Jeremy Benoist
0d3bafdfdf Remove tab from baggy css
And add a border left on the filter slider
2015-09-23 07:51:17 +02:00
Jeremy Benoist
98f0929f16 Handle entry in language
Fix #1333
2015-09-22 20:52:13 +02:00
Jeremy Benoist
db96045a0a Adjust preview picture 2015-09-20 22:36:51 +02:00
Nicolas Lœuillet
1db9d411c5 Merge pull request #1420 from modos189/v2_display_picture
improved display pictures
2015-09-14 17:15:40 +02:00
Alexandr Danilov
451bad02f0 improved display pictures 2015-09-14 02:12:39 +03:00
Thomas Citharel
1a5f7e2d88 A little more width for filter view 2015-09-13 19:53:09 +02:00
Jeremy Benoist
5e98404dfb Re-add preview picture on baggy
Which should has been removed on merge
2015-09-13 15:17:58 +02:00
Jeremy Benoist
5def3f5862 Filters view on side for baggy 2015-09-13 14:56:34 +02:00
Jeremy Benoist
71e51207ce Fix tests 2015-09-13 14:56:34 +02:00
Jeremy Benoist
1137fae94d Lower domain search length
When searching for "bbc" I got no result .. sigh.
2015-09-13 13:35:12 +02:00
Jeremy Benoist
d2fcbf5d84 Handle filter form using some JS
Instead of displaying an ugly form
2015-09-13 13:35:12 +02:00
Jeremy Benoist
19c283140e Cleanup base layout 2015-09-13 13:35:12 +02:00
Jeremy Benoist
89ee994f77 Remove some global assets
Some global assets where dedicated to baggy
Remove some non-used css
2015-09-13 13:35:12 +02:00
Jeremy Benoist
a78d6afeaa Move baggy theme in its folder 2015-09-13 13:35:12 +02:00
Jeremy Benoist
4d5fd9be81 Merge pull request #1417 from wallabag/v2-display-picture
fix #972: add preview pictures
2015-09-13 11:41:23 +02:00
Jeremy Benoist
40f59b219b Merge pull request #1418 from wallabag/v2-previewpicture-filter
filter for entries with previewPicture
2015-09-13 10:14:42 +02:00
Nicolas Lœuillet
497e0cad7c add test for previewPicture filter 2015-09-13 10:11:22 +02:00
Nicolas Lœuillet
b026d3b115 add previewPicture on baggy theme 2015-09-13 10:03:53 +02:00
Nicolas Lœuillet
616f9fea26 forgot case for previewPicture filter 2015-09-13 08:43:15 +02:00
Nicolas Lœuillet
a3bcd60a37 filter for entries with previewPicture 2015-09-12 17:08:12 +02:00
Nicolas Lœuillet
e610143f51 add preview pictures 2015-09-12 13:39:01 +02:00
Jeremy Benoist
af43bd3767 Fix tests
Ensure that created use during install command will always be unique.
We assume that the install command must be run to initialize a wallabag instance. NEVER to add more user.

Also, use a better way to retrieve the real name of the database and not the one defined in parameters.yml (which isn't the same for test envi because the dbname isn't defined in parameters.yml but directly in config_test.yml)
2015-09-12 11:36:16 +02:00
Nicolas Lœuillet
3f7a62908c fix tests for FosUser 2015-09-11 20:32:37 +02:00
Nicolas Lœuillet
a1691859ca implement FosUser 2015-09-11 20:32:37 +02:00
Nicolas Lœuillet
9c08a891f9 Merge pull request #1397 from wallabag/v2-graby
Integrate graby
2015-09-11 20:17:42 +02:00
Jeremy Benoist
f1e29e69cb CS 2015-09-10 22:00:53 +02:00
Jeremy Benoist
558d9aabab Move fetching content in a separate class 2015-09-10 21:57:25 +02:00
Thomas Citharel
e643992350 typo 2015-08-26 00:24:33 +02:00
Thomas Citharel
b125ed0394 Use full size of the panel for domain-filtering
For longer domains
2015-08-26 00:19:17 +02:00
Nicolas Lœuillet
50243f0e34 fix #1357, truncate domain name if it's too loooong 2015-08-24 22:09:57 +02:00
Jeremy Benoist
d13de40db6 Update url from graby 2015-08-24 19:52:31 +02:00
Jeremy Benoist
a1413a3da9 CS 2015-08-24 12:35:02 +02:00
Jeremy Benoist
fad316151c Integrate graby 2015-08-24 12:27:17 +02:00
Jeremy Benoist
8c55a9e6c9 Merge pull request #1395 from wallabag/v2-fix-1378
fix #1378: nice display for tags list
2015-08-24 12:16:08 +02:00
Jeremy Benoist
dc1c2debfb Apply margin only on settings page 2015-08-24 12:03:00 +02:00
Nicolas Lœuillet
a754db33c9 fix #1378: nice display for tags list 2015-08-24 11:59:53 +02:00
Nicolas Lœuillet
7083d183b9 Merge pull request #1392 from wallabag/v2-fix-redirect
Fix redirect after deletion
2015-08-24 10:44:14 +02:00
Nicolas Lœuillet
8bb1f3d69a Merge pull request #1393 from wallabag/fix-filter-same-day
Fix date filter on same day
2015-08-24 10:39:24 +02:00
Jeremy Benoist
f90af145ca Add test for same day filter 2015-08-23 22:06:27 +02:00
Nicolas Lœuillet
bccb5bba75 Merge pull request #1384 from wallabag/v2-fix-config-display
fix #1371 config screen: display bug in RSS tab
2015-08-23 13:17:21 +02:00
Jeremy Benoist
7d6c3edcdd Fix date filter on same day
Fix #1379
2015-08-22 15:36:07 +02:00
Jeremy Benoist
ec00964de2 Merge pull request #1372 from wallabag/v2-assign-tags
assign tags to an entry
2015-08-22 12:56:42 +02:00
Nicolas Lœuillet
7244d6cb61 assign tags to an entry 2015-08-22 12:40:48 +02:00
Jeremy Benoist
83aaf84195 Fix display issue in config rss tab 2015-08-22 12:30:06 +02:00
Jeremy Benoist
16a3d04cbd Fix redirect after deletion
Fix #1391
2015-08-22 12:09:27 +02:00
Jeremy Benoist
f506da40e2 Merge pull request #1385 from wallabag/v2-status-filter
filters: implement status filter and a new view (to display all entries)
2015-08-21 17:49:20 +02:00
Nicolas Lœuillet
c937de3443 remove dead code 2015-08-21 08:36:57 +02:00
Nicolas Lœuillet
2b7a488917 filters: adapt queryBuilder for 'all' view 2015-08-21 07:38:18 +02:00
Nicolas Lœuillet
e177976099 filters: add test for status filter and adapt other tests results 2015-08-21 07:30:48 +02:00
Nicolas Lœuillet
89659c9eae filters: implement status filter and a new view (to display all entries) 2015-08-21 07:30:48 +02:00
Jeremy Benoist
6682139ec5 CS 2015-08-20 20:39:52 +02:00
Jeremy Benoist
e6f55346fd Add test on getting starred entries using the API 2015-08-20 20:39:26 +02:00
Jeremy Benoist
eccf5eb2e0 Add title in "picto-link"
Picto aren't always obvious for every one. So it's better to have some title when we move the mouse over.
2015-08-20 20:39:26 +02:00
Jeremy Benoist
1dbcd63b59 Update baggy about page
According to what have been done on the material theme
2015-08-20 20:39:26 +02:00
Jeremy Benoist
4793ee6509 Fixed my name & website 👌 2015-08-20 20:39:26 +02:00
Jeremy Benoist
6eebd8c909 Remove unsed things 2015-08-20 20:39:26 +02:00
Jeremy Benoist
0ab7404f93 Refactorize the way to retrieve entries
One place to retrieve entries in Entry & Rss controller.
More simple and easy to maintain.
2015-08-20 20:39:22 +02:00
Jeremy Benoist
8ce32af612 CS
We shouldn't forget to run `php-cs-fixer` time to time
2015-08-20 07:53:55 +02:00
Jeremy Benoist
34437f408c Merge pull request #1369 from wallabag/v2-bottombar
fix #1332: bottom bar to display message
2015-08-19 21:27:49 +02:00
Jeremy Benoist
ab4aeb8bd8 Merge pull request #1375 from wallabag/v2-fix-1371
fix #1368 config: redirect on correct tab in material theme
2015-08-19 21:26:29 +02:00
Nicolas Lœuillet
fdab81e910 warning bar: add parameter to dis/enable it 2015-08-19 16:00:15 +02:00
Nicolas Lœuillet
e62d27ff9b bottom bar to display message 2015-08-19 15:14:08 +02:00
Nicolas Lœuillet
8b8cdabc89 config: redirect on correct tab in material theme 2015-08-19 15:10:11 +02:00
Nicolas Lœuillet
bdd23b076a filters: enhance view for domain name 2015-08-19 14:55:39 +02:00
Nicolas Lœuillet
443cecd2d8 add filter on domain name 2015-08-19 14:27:00 +02:00
Jeremy Benoist
b71ebd9af9 Merge pull request #1366 from wallabag/fix-tags-view
fix tag view in material theme
2015-08-19 12:02:24 +02:00